Output 17fdee659bbc2d7568aeeaaee26f181a94a967630414558ccc0555f3dd1ef315:0

value
26522252
script pubkey
OP_0 OP_PUSHBYTES_20 132cbf75c2dc3787ca41a43de092fef74f83f664
address
ltc1qzvkt7awzmsmc0jjp5s77pyh77a8c8anyhq69x9
transaction
17fdee659bbc2d7568aeeaaee26f181a94a967630414558ccc0555f3dd1ef315
spent
true